The end of season tour was a blast, big thanks to Barbra B and Helen for organising. This year we performed a ‘Dusking’ as the last dance of the day. This is a way of celebrating the return of the dark long nights. We removed our baldricks and bells and stopped the music emulating how the trees loose their leaves while Ashleigh clash a pair of sticks for the dancers to keep to the beat. I’m not sure the crowd knew what was happening but I think it made a fitting end to the dancing out season. Find out more about dusking here.
